A compound sentence joins two complete ideas.

The stand-alone test

I tightened the fitting. I went home. I tightened the fitting, and I went home.

Joined on purpose

Each side has a subject and a verb and can stand alone. Because I was late cannot stand alone — that is not this page.

I tightened the fitting and went home. — fine, shared subject
I tightened the fitting, and I went home. — two full clauses
